Etymology[edit]
Form Ancient Greek ἀ- (a-, “not”) + βάρος (báros, “weight”) + γνῶσις (gnôsis, “knowledge”).[1]
Pronunciation[edit]
Noun[edit]
abarognosis (uncountable)
- A loss of the ability to realise or estimate the weight of an object
